Pojaman might meet Gen Prem : Noppadon

Khunying Pojaman Shinawatra might meet Privy Council President Prem Tinsulanonda at a "suitable time", according to her family's legal adviser Noppadon Pattama.



"She is a respectable person. So it is normal if she meets a senior member of the country on a suitable occasion," he said.

There are rumours that the wife of ousted prime minister Thaksin is seeking a meeting with Prem.

Pojaman met Prem after her husband was overthrown in 2006.

Noppadon insisted Pojaman returned to Thailand to fight corruption charges against her only, and not to play a role in screening potential Cabinet members.

"There is an attempt to discredit the People Power Party by linking it with a nominee of deposed prime minister Thaksin," he said.

Pojaman went shopping on Thursday with children Panthongtae, Pinthongta and Paethongtarn at Gaysorn Department Store.

Meanwhile, Thaksin quietly left Hong Kong on a flight to London Thursday, two days after his wife was arrested on corruption charges in this country, Associated Press reported.

Thaksin has lived abroad since his ouster in the September 2006 coup, mostly shuttling between Hong Kong and London, where he owns an apartment.

Dressed in a dark suit, Thaksin chatted on his mobile phone as he waited in line with other passengers at the Hong Kong International Airport to board his flight.

"He will be going to London," said Noppadon. "I don't know the reason. He's a free man."
